The FISC Norfolk, Philadelphia Division intends to acquire, on a sole source basis, continued development and implementation of an Internet Web-based, Department of Navy Criminal Justice Information System (DONCJIS) on behalf of the Naval Criminal Investigative Service (NCIS) representing the interests of the U.S. Navy (USN) and U.S. Marine Corps (USMC) Law Enforcement, Corrections, Judge Advocate General (JAG) judicial components, and the Defense Incident Based Reporting System (DIBRS) Component Responsible Officials (CRO). This is a requirement for a contractor to provide full life cycle software development services (requirements analysis, project management and planning, design, development, testing, documentation and training, implementation, and post-implementation support) for a new Criminal Incident and Case Management System. The Department of the Navy Criminal Justice Information System (DONCJIS) is an evolutionary next step in the modernization of the Consolidated Law Enforcement Operations Center (CLEOC) and will serve as the Navys cradle-to-grave law enforcement information system by incorporating data on criminal investigations and their associated legal proceedings and correctional records. The primary objective for DONCJIS is to provide a web-based interface for data entry of criminal incident and case data; incorporate business processes and workflow requirements from the law enforcement, investigative, judicial, and corrections user community; enhance the existing systems for US Navy and Marine Corps Law Enforcement, JAG, and Corrections users; provide full data processing and case tracking capabilities from incident to corrections; include in-depth reporting capabilities, data extracts, and statistical analysis of criminal data; and solve limited network bandwidth problems for users who connect to the system via dial-up connections. These development and implementation services are currently being performed by InterImage, Inc. under FISC Contract N00140-05-D-0058 which was competitively awarded as a small business set-aside. This is a cost plus fixed fee type contract on which delivery orders are issued. Due to unanticipated growth of the DONCJIS user population and consequent revisions to the system requirements, the contract ceiling and estimated level of effort has been exhausted. It is therefore necessary to modify the current contract in order to add sufficient ceiling and hours to complete development and implementation of the DONCJIS System thru final system approval. It is estimated that approximately 93,813 additional hours of effort will be added to the contract in order to complete DONCJIS development. The period of performance of the contract is expected to extend thru 31 March 2009 including final system acceptance and initial operations. It is further anticipated that a competitive solicitation will be issued in the near future for the operation and maintenance of the completed DONCJIS system as well as potential future development tasks associated with DONCJIS. The new contract would take over after completion of the current contract. The currently proposed contract action is for supplies or services for which the Government intends to solicit and negotiate with only one source under authority of FAR 6.302. Interested persons may identify their interest and capability to respond to the requirement or submit proposals. This notice of intent is not a request for competitive proposals. However, all proposals received after date of publication of this synopsis will be considered by the Government. A determination by the Government not to compete this proposed contracting action based upon responses to this notice is solely within the discretion of the Government. Information received will normally be considered solely for the purpose of determining whether to conduct a competitive procurement.
